Image Smoothing Via L0 Gradient Minimization

We present a new image editing method,particularly effective for sharpening major edges by increasing the steepness of transition while eliminating a manageable degree of low-amplitude structures. The seemingly contradictive effect is achieved in an optimization framework making use of L0 gradient minimization,which can globally control how many non-zero gradients are resulted in to approximate prominent structure in a sparsity-control manner. Unlike other edge-preserving smoothing approaches,our method does not depend on local features,but instead globally locates important edges. It,as a fundamental tool,finds many applications and is particularly beneficial to edge extraction,clipart JPEG artifact removal,and non-photorealistic effect generation.
